Anti-Pollution Measures Get More Stringent To Tackle Situation Reaching Emergency Levels

[vc_row][vc_column][vc_column_text]Pollution level in Delhi region set alarm bells ringing and measures were set in motion to meet what has become a health hazard and a serious emergency.

Swinging into action, the National Green Tribunal (NGT) ordered a ban on old vehicles and trucks with construction material from the national capital region on Thursday morning, strengthening curbs. It also came down heavily on authorities for failing to check the pollution build-up.

The Delhi government has decided to bring back from Monday the odd-even scheme in which odd and even numbered vehicles ply on alternate days. Media reports quoting government sources said that the scheme will be implemented from November 13 and will continue till November 17. Vehicles with odd registration numbers will ply on odd dates and the ones with even numbers will ply on even days. Last time, the restrictions were in place from 8am to 8pm.

Earlier, the Delhi high court issued orders to the Union and state governments to hold emergency meetings within three days to tackle the smog crisis and explore options such as bringing back the Odd-Even restrictions – an alternate-day vehicle rationing system.

At the same time, the National Human Rights Commission (NHRC), taking cognisance of media reports, also stepped in, observing that it is apparent that the concerned authorities have not taken proper steps throughout the year to tackle this hazard, which is amounting to violation of the Right to Life and Health of the residents in the region.

The NGT said diesel vehicles older than 10 years, petrol cars older than 15 years would not be allowed to enter Delhi and trucks carrying construction material must be stopped in the entire NCR, which includes cities of Haryana, Uttar Pradesh and Rajasthan, the National Green Tribunal ordered, according to news agency ANI.

The NGT pulled up the Delhi government, the city’s municipal corporations and governments in neighbouring states for “playing” with the lives of people. “It is shameful for all the parties in this matter on what they’re passing on to the next generation,” the NGT observed.

Questioning the seriousness of the neighbouring states of Delhi in tackling pollution, NGT said even construction work hasn’t stopped despite its earlier order.

“Even construction work taking place openly isn’t being stopped, and when such a situation has ensued now action is being promised,” it said. Saying that curbing pollution is a joint responsibility of all stakeholders, NGT said that people are being denied their Right to Life.

“Articles 21 & 48 of the Constitution mandate that it is the responsibility of governments to make sure that citizens get a clean and conducive environment. Right to life is being snatched from people since they’re not getting a clean environment,” ANI quoted the tribunal as saying.

Citing a report by the Central Pollution Control Board, the NGT said PM 10 and PM 2.5 levels have been alarmingly high in the past week. “CPCB’s report has shown the extent of danger lurking in the air in Delhi NCR. Yesterday PM 10 levels, supposed to be 100, had touched 986, while the PM 2.5 levels, supposed to be 60, had reached 420. This has been the situation since the past week,” it said.

The green body also questioned Delhi government on the steps it had taken to control pollution and the number of challans it issued to violators, and the number of construction sites where work has been stopped. It also enquired why helicopters weren’t being used to sprinkle water.

It ordered industries to stop work in Delhi till the next hearing and directed the government to depute personnel to monitor activities causing pollution.

It also called for a ban on trucks carrying construction material in Delhi NCR and asked the government to prohibit the entry of diesel vehicles older than 10 years and petrol vehicles older than 15 years.

The Delhi High Court said cloud seeding to create artificial rain could also be considered. It also asked the Kejriwal government to consider implementing “odd-even vehicle movement scheme” as a short-term measure. Further, it has directed the Union Ministry of Environment, Forest & Climate Change secretary to hold an emergency meeting on pollution with chief secretaries of NCR states and pollution control agencies within three days.

The NHRC, expressing concern, sought reports, within two weeks, from the different Union Ministries and Governments of Delhi, Haryana and Punjab about the effective steps taken and proposed to be taken by them to tackle the situation.

It issued notices to the Secretaries of Union Ministry of Environment, Forest and Climate Change, Ministry of Health and Family Welfare and Ministry of Highways and Road Transport along with the Chief Secretaries of the Governments of NCT of Delhi, Punjab and Haryana.

The Secretary, Ministry of Health and Family Welfare is expected to give details about the preparedness of the government hospitals and other agencies to attend to the people affected by pollution and steps taken to create awareness among the public at large.

The NHRC emphasised immediate need for effective action by the Union and the State agencies and proper implementation of the environmental laws. “The state cannot leave its citizens to die due to the toxic haze,” it said.[/vc_column_text][/vc_column][/vc_row]

What is Ensure?

Ensure is an American for nutritional supplements and replacements for meals. This brand, Ensure is manufactured by Abbott Laboratories.

Read Also: Amazon updates Alexa: Now you can move music between multiple echo devices, here’s how to do it!

Ensure Original contains 220 calories, six grams of saturated fat, 15 grams of sugar, and nine grams of protein in a 237-ml (8-fl oz) bottle. Water, corn maltodextrin, sugar, milk protein concentrate, canola oil, and soy protein isolate are the top six ingredients in Ensure original. For people with lactose intolerance can also take this as Ensure is considered lactose-free.

The much-awaited film from Rohit Shetty’s cop universe, Sooryavanshi hit the silver screens on November 5. Apart from the movie’s plot, the Akshay Kumar and Katrina Kaif starrer is ruling the hearts of the audience with its peppy songs. Recently, the makers have dropped the remake of the iconic 90s song Tip Tip Barsa Paani that has been recreated by Katrina and Akshay.

The original Tip Tip Barsa Paani song from Mohra film was voiced by the singers, noted singers Udit Narayan and Alka Yagnik. It came out in the year 1994 wherein the audience had witnessed the sizzling chemistry between Raveena Tandon and Akshay Kumar.

Raveena Tandon likes tweets hailing original Tip Tip Barsa Paani

Soon after the song was released, fans started comparing it to the original song from the film Mohra, which featured Raveena Tandon and Akshay Kumar. The recreated version by Kat and Akki sent the mercury soaring and is receiving rave reviews, however, a section of fans had conflicting opinions about Katrina’s performance. While some of them admired her performance, others felt that it did not match the original version.

One of the fans tweeted that the original tip tip barsa pani is something else, that too in the early 90s. The Tip Tip Barsa Pani star has liked the tweets wherein the audience have praised the original version of the song.

Tip Tip song from Sooryavanshi

In the song, Katrina Kaif can be seen donning a silver metallic saree and her scintillating moves will surely make you fall head over heels in love with her. While Katrina is dancing in the rain, Akshay can be seen admiring her. The song has a carnival set up and has been recreated by Tanishk Bagchi.

Finally, the wait is over, after a long time this new song Lala Bheemla has been released today. It is debuted by the filmmakers of the upcoming film Bheemla Nayak, which stars superstar Pawan Kalyan.

Lala Bheemla is a song with such a high level of energy and music. The song is composed by S Thaman and released on the occasion of Trivikram’s birthday who is a lyricist and dialogue writer for the film.

Manobala Vijayabalan tweeted about the song release with the date, song name and the name of filmstar Pawan Kalyan.

The song is based on strong composition, intense lyrics, aggressive vocals, and hair-raising imagery which absolutely meets beyond the expectations.

It’s a treat to watch Pawan Kalyan dressed as a cop in a mass avatar in Lungi. The female dancers from Odisha in the background are also enhancing the mass appeal.

The fact that Trivikram Srinivas, who produced the film’s screenplay and dialogues, also wrote the song’s lyrics is intriguing. Because of his energetic singing, Arun Kaundinya totally changed the mood of the song which is an absolute game-changer.

If we talk about the production of the film, Naga Vamsi has produced the film under the company Sithara Entertainments. Fans of the actor Pawan Kalyan are amazed to hear this incredible song. Therefore, Bheemla Nayak is set to hit the theatres in Sankranthi 2022.

Nithya Menen also plays the lead role in Bheemla Nayak. S Thaman is in charge of the film’s musical score, while Ravi K. Chandran and Naveen Nooli are the cinematographer and editor, respectively.
